首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>用AVFoundation逐帧录制音视频

用AVFoundation逐帧录制音视频
EN

Stack Overflow用户
提问于 2011-11-08 04:54:48
回答 2查看 3.2K关注 0票数 6

如何使用AVFoundation逐帧在iOS4中录制音频和视频?

EN

回答 2

Stack Overflow用户

发布于 2011-11-08 05:26:12

您提到的AVCamDemo接近您需要做的事情,并且应该能够使用它作为引用,其中包括您需要使用的以下类,以便实现您正在尝试的……所有的类都是AVFoundation的一部分,您需要

  • AVCaptureVideoDataOutputAVCaptutureAudioDataOutput -使用这些类从摄像机和麦克风中获取原始样本。
  • 使用AVAssetWriterAVAssetWriterInput将原始示例编码到文件中--下面的示例mac 项目演示了如何使用这些类(该示例也适用于ios ),但是它们使用AVAssetReader作为输入(它重新编码电影文件)而不是照相机和麦克风.在您的情况下,您可以使用上面提到的输出作为输入来编写您想要的东西。

为了实现你想要做的事,那应该是你需要的.

下面是一个显示如何使用VideoDataOutput的链接

希望它能帮上忙

票数 5
EN

Stack Overflow用户

发布于 2011-11-10 22:15:41

如果您是注册开发人员,请查看2011年WWDC的视频(您可以通过搜索developer门户找到这些视频)。有两个与AVFoundation有关的会话。还有一些来自一个WWDC会话的示例代码,这是非常有用的。

票数 3
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/8046102

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档